Our Company:
Confie and its family of companies - Freeway, Baja, Bluefire & others - is one of the largest privately held insurance brokers in the United States. We have been ranked the #1 Personal Lines Leader by the Insurance Journal for eight consecutive years! With more than 800 retail locations nationwide, we are committed to helping our employees take their careers and income potential to new heights. What You Will Do:
The Assistant Manager role will challenge your sales ability, reward your achievements, and provide mentorship opportunities, giving you the chance to build lasting relationships, expand your expertise, and be rewarded for your success.
- Drive growth: Connect with customers and expand business opportunities by offering auto, homeowners, or health insurance solutions to meet and exceed sales production goals
- Drive results: Assist Store Manager to oversee team performance, track progress, and ensure operational targets are met.
- Problem-solve: Handle customer service issues with professionalism and care.
- Ensure Accuracy: Maintain records of all transactions, including timely deposits and documentation in the agency management system.
